WebThe non-lexical or sub-lexical route is a mechanism for decoding novel words using existing grapheme-to-phoneme rules in a language. This mechanism operates through the identification of a word’s constituent parts (such as graphemes) and applying linguistic rules to decoding. Another common feature of ... WebGrapheme A written letter or a group of letters representing one speech sound. Examples: b, sh, ch, igh, eigh. Onset An initial consonant or consonant cluster. In the word name, n is the onset; in the word blue, bl is the onset. Rime The vowel or vowel and consonant (s) that follow the onset. In the word name, ame is the rime. Digraph

Webfor example, the spelling “ch” represents different sounds in words drawn from Germanic (cheap, rich, such), Greek (chemist, anchor, echo) and French (chef, brochure, … WebThe fact that /ch/ contains two letters is a little frustrating for most of us, but it just happens to be a limitation of the English alphabet that we don’t have a single, unified symbol—a letter, or grapheme—to represent the single, unified phoneme we hear at the beginning of the word choke. So “ch” is also a grapheme, even though it ...
